This document describes a study on tracking signal-emitting mobile targets using navigated mobile sensors based on signal reception measurements. The study proposes using a min-max approximation approach and semidefinite programming relaxation to jointly estimate the locations of the mobile sensor and target in order to improve tracking accuracy. A cubic function is used for mobile sensor navigation, and a weighted tracking algorithm is also proposed to make more efficient use of measurement information and provide good tracking performance by quickly directing the mobile sensor to follow the mobile target.
